Dental Implant Treatment

  • Description
Description

Dental implant treatment is a modern medical procedure that is used to replace missing or damaged teeth. In this procedure, dentist place a small titanium post into the jawbone which acts as an artificial tooth. This treatment provide a permanent solution for missing teeth. Who Needs Dental Implant Treatment?

A person who has lost one or more teeth due to injury or other causes can obtain this implant treatment. Dental implant treatment is highly recommended for those patients who want permanent solutions. You may need this treatment if:

  • You have missing or damaged teeth.
  • You have healthy gums and adequate jawbone density.
  • Want a long lasting alternative to bridges or dentures for missing or damaged teeth.

Types of Dental Implants

  • Single Tooth Implant: A single tooth dental implant treatment is used when a patient has one missing tooth. The implant functions as a root replacement which allows a dental crown to be positioned on top to create a natural appearing and durable restoration.
  • Multiple Tooth Implants: Multiple dental implants provide support for bridges or partial dentures when several teeth are missing. This method protects nearby healthy teeth from sustaining damage.
  • Full Mouth Dental Implants: Full mouth dental implants provide a solution for patients who have lost most of their teeth or all of their teeth. The procedure requires multiple implants to create a foundation for a complete set of fixed teeth.
  • All-on-4 Dental Implants: The All-on-4 dental implant technique is a popular solution for full mouth restoration. It uses four strategically placed implants to support an entire arch of teeth.

Benefits of Dental Implant Treatment

  • It is a permanent tooth solution that provides a stable and supports durable artificial tooth.
  • Dental implant treatment provides a feeling like natural teeth and proper bite strength and stability.
  • It allows you to chew food comfortably and speak without denture movement.
  • Helps to prevent bone deterioration and maintain facial structure after tooth loss.

Procedure Dental Implant Treatment

The dental implant treatment procedure is done with several stages which ensures proper healing and long term results.

  • Before the Procedure: Before going to the treatment, the dentist performs some physical tests to evaluate the issue. The tests include:
    • Dental examination and oral health assessment
    • Digital X-Rays and CT-Scan
    • Examination of Jawbone Density
  • During the Procedure: During the dental implant surgery, dentists perform a minor surgery where they place titanium implant into the jawbone. The implant acts as an artificial tooth. The recovery and healing process may take couple of weeks or a month. After recovery, a crown is placed on the top that provides natural look.
  • After the Procedure: After completion of procedure, the patient may experience mild swelling and discomfort for few days. The recommendations from a dentist are:
    • You have to maintain good oral hygiene.
    • You have to avoid hard food for some times.
    • Take a proper diet and medication as per the doctor’s guidance.
    • Attend regular dental visits for monitoring.

Success Rate of Dental Implants in India

The success rate of dental implants in India is high when surgery is performed by an experienced dentist. According to the Indian clinical data success rates may range from 95% to 98%. But, these number may vary due to factors which are given below:

  • Jawbone density is very crucial for a successful dental implant surgery.
  • Maintaining a good oral hygiene is essential for long term implant results.
  • Skilled dentist is also an affecting factor for a successful surgery.
  • Patient’s health status or condition may affect the success rate.
  • Smoking and Tabacco may reduce the blood supply to the gums.

Risks and Complications of Dental Implants

  • If the implant is placed too close to nearby teeth, they may be affected.
  • Fusion process may delayed due to healing of jawbone after implantation.
  • Bacteria may be occurs after surgery.
  • Improper implant placement may cause numbness and pain in the lips or tongue.
